    I found that repeating back something also gives someone a chance to back out and change their mind. In the help desk world, this helped immensely.

    “Why did we lose connection to Sydney?”

    “Ah… Dunno.”

    “What do your network logs say?”

    “Ah… We don’t have logs on those routers.”

    “… Okay, let me see if I understand, since I will have to report back to my boss, who will contact yours. Our connection to Sydney went down, but the routers on your end do not keep logs, so you are unable to tell me why. And your boss will back you up on this. Correct?”

    “… I’ll look again.”

    “That’s what I thought.”
